Transaction 364da372458c75bd95e79ea74e590771a726437bc98e218c8cbc60978c93538c

1 Input
2 Outputs
  • 364da372458c75bd95e79ea74e590771a726437bc98e218c8cbc60978c93538c:0
  • value  110029544
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
  • 364da372458c75bd95e79ea74e590771a726437bc98e218c8cbc60978c93538c:1
  • value  447339
    address  bc1qdtme9p5m3hy5te8waj03qwtun5cpa64gsztxgk